In recent years California citizens have decided against new 
electric power generation  projects  within their jurisdiction and to 
enforce strict air pollution standards on any existing facilities.  

This is great as long as the people making this decision pay the 
cost.  Unfortunately the cost of these decisions are not being borne 
only be the citizens of California.  The bad decisions of the citizens 
of California have produced an energy crisis in what is called the 
Northwest for which all citizens in what is called the Northwest must 
pay the price.

Here I sit in Vancouver BC Canada paying outrageous prices for 
natural gas because of the demand in California for natural gas for 
heating and electrical generation purposes.  I feel California should 
pay for their previous decisions themselves, if you don't want power 
plants don't use power or pay the complete premium for your 
decision.

Of course the system can never be made to work in this way so 
here I sit in Canada paying for bad decisions in California.
